About The Role
As an Examination Invigilator, you will help ensure the smooth running of examinations by:
- Preparing examination rooms, including setting out desks, equipment, and materials.
- Admitting candidates and ensuring examination procedures are followed.
- Distributing and collecting examination papers and materials.
- Supervising students during examinations and maintaining a calm and focused environment.
- Ensuring examination regulations and academy procedures are adhered to at all times.
- Reporting any irregularities or concerns to the Exams Officer.
- Assisting with the secure handling and organisation of examination materials before and after exams.
- Remaining vigilant throughout examinations and maintaining the integrity of the examination process at all times.
